Two persons were killed when they came under the wheels of moving trains in separate incidents, here on Tuesday, police said.
In the first incident, Ashish Kumar, 16, came under a moving train in Ashok Nagar area in north-east Delhi.
The accident occurred while he was crossing tracks at around 6.30 am.
“He was on his way to attend a tution class in Ashok Nagar when he was run down by New Delhi bound Saharanpur train. The body has been sent to Guru Teg Bahadur Hospital for post-mortem,” police said.
In the third incident, Shyamlal Kapoor, 55, came under a moving train in east Delhi’s Vivek Vihar area, police said.
